Negotiate with 02

Last year I spent around £900 for 2 users on contract with 02 - so I bought 2 pay as you go chips (£10). Rang 02 to confirm numbers etc they asked why we wanted to change, I said they 02 were way to expensive to use on contract - they offered to reduce my monthly contract amount by 50% (yes! saving £450) if I stayed on contract with them ...I of course agreed. So do look to negotiate.

    Good money saving moment of the morning today :D

    I'm with O2 Online (the non in-store deals on their site) - currently on £30/month, 500 texts, 200 mins. Contract up in a couple of weeks.

    Orange have started doing the same online only deals - they were offering same tariff as I'm on, but half price (£15) for the first three months, and a free Nokia N70 (I'm a Nokia junky).

    Phoned O2 to cancel, got put through to Customer Retention. I said if they'd match Orange I'd stay, and without me even asking they offered instead to better - I'm now getting half price line rental for the entire year. So £15/month for 500 texts and 200 minutes. :D

    They couldn't do the N70 free, but did offer a load of others so could have got a good free one. But particularly wanted that so paying £80 for it. However, saving £135 over the year compared to Orange so it still nets out ok.

    Just feeling good, and a reminder to all to threaten cancellation at the end of every contract. :)

    Also, if you're an MMS fan, O2 are great because MMS are included in your free text allowance (albeit one MMS uses up 4 free texts).
